Key Lime Cake with Key Lime Cream Cheese Frosting

Directions

  1. 1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. 2Grease and flour two 8-inch round cake pans, or line them with parchment paper circles for easy release.
  3. 3In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
  4. 4In a large mixing bowl, beat the butter and granulated sugar with an electric mixer until light and fluffy (about 3–4 minutes).
  5. 5Beat in the eggs, one at a time, ensuring each is fully incorporated.
  6. 6Add the lime zest and mix until combined.
  7. 7On low speed, add the flour mixture in three additions, alternating with the buttermilk and lime juice. Begin and end with the flour mixture.
  8. 8Stir in the vanilla extract until smooth, being careful not to overmix.
  9. 9Divide the batter evenly between the prepared pans.
  10. 10Smooth the tops and bake for 25–30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  11. 11Let the cakes cool in the pans for 10 minutes, then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.
  12. 12In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ese and butter until smooth and creamy.
  13. 13Gradually add the powdered sugar, one cup at a time, beating until fluffy.
  14. 14Add lime juice, zest, vanilla, and a pinch of salt. Beat until silky smooth.
  15. 15Place one cooled cake layer on a serving plate.
  16. 16Spread a thick layer of frosting on top.
  17. 17Place the second cake layer over it, then frost the entire cake with a smooth coat.
  18. 18Use a piping bag for decorative swirls on top if desired.
  19. 19Sprinkle with extra lime zest for garnish.
  20. 20Refrigerate the cake for about 30 minutes before slicing to help the frosting set.
  21. 21Serve chilled or at room temperature, and enjoy the refreshing lime flavor in every bite!

Ingredients

  • 2.5 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2.5 tsp baking powder
  • 0.5 tsp baking soda
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s, room temperature
  • 1 Tbsp lime zest (preferably from key limes)
  • 0.5 cup fresh key lime juice (or bottled if fresh isn’t available)
  • 1 cup buttermilk, room temperature
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 0.5 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 4 cups powdered sugar, sifted
  • 2 Tbsp fresh key lime juice
  • 1 tsp lime zest
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 pinch salt

Tips

  • Ensure butter and granulated sugar are beaten until light and fluffy for a tender crumb.
  • Be careful not to overmix the batter.
  • Refrigerate the cake for about 30 minutes before slicing to help the frosting set.
